Understanding Stick Welding and Its Advantages

Stick welding, also known as Shielded Metal Arc Welding (SMAW), is one of the most widely used welding processes. It involves using a consumable electrode coated in flux to lay the weld. The flux coating disintegrates, providing a shielding gas and a layer of slag, both of which protect the weld area from atmospheric contamination.

Key Advantages of Stick Welding:

  1. Versatility

    • Stick welding can be performed in various environments, including outdoor and windy conditions, making it suitable for construction, maintenance, and repair work.
  2. Simplicity and Cost-Effectiveness

    • The equipment for stick welding is relatively simple and inexpensive, making it accessible for beginners and hobbyists.
  3. Strong and Durable Welds

    • Stick welding produces strong welds that are highly resistant to stress and can join a wide variety of metals.

Types of Lincoln Stick Welders

Lincoln Electric offers a variety of stick welders to meet different welding needs. Here are some popular models:

  1. Lincoln Electric AC/DC 225/125 Stick Welder

    • Features: Dual voltage capability (120V/240V), smooth arc, and easy-to-use selector switch.
    • Applications: Ideal for maintenance, repair, and general fabrication work.
  2. Lincoln Electric Invertec V155-S

    • Features: Lightweight, portable design, inverter technology for superior arc performance, and multi-process capabilities (stick and TIG).
    • Applications: Suitable for on-site welding, repair work, and maintenance operations.
  3. Lincoln Electric Idealarc 250 Stick Welder

    • Features: High duty cycle, exceptional arc stability, and robust construction.
    • Applications: Best suited for industrial applications requiring high amperage and extended duty cycles.
  4. Lincoln Electric Power MIG 210 MP Multi-Process Welder

    • Features: Versatile multi-process capabilities (MIG, TIG, stick, and flux-cored), intuitive interface, and dual voltage input.
    • Applications: Perfect for small shop owners, hobbyists, and DIY enthusiasts who need a versatile and easy-to-use welder.

Choosing the Right Lincoln Stick Welder

Selecting the right Lincoln stick welder depends on several factors, including the type of welding you perform, the materials you work with, and your specific welding needs. Here are some tips to help you choose the best model:

  1. Consider Your Welding Applications

    • Determine the primary applications for your stick welder. For instance, if you work primarily on maintenance and repair, a model like the Lincoln Electric AC/DC 225/125 Stick Welder would be ideal.
  2. Evaluate the Required Amperage and Duty Cycle

    • Choose a welder with the appropriate amperage range and duty cycle for your projects. Higher amperage and duty cycle ratings are necessary for heavy-duty and continuous welding operations.
  3. Look for Versatility

    • Select a welder that offers multi-process capabilities if you need flexibility in your welding tasks. Models like the Lincoln Electric Power MIG 210 MP provide options for MIG, TIG, stick, and flux-cored welding.
  4. Check for Portability

    • If you need to move your welder frequently, choose a lightweight, portable model like the Lincoln Electric Invertec V155-S.

Maintenance Tips for Lincoln Stick Welders

Proper maintenance of your Lincoln stick welder is essential to ensure its longevity and optimal performance. Here are some maintenance tips to keep your welder in top condition:

  1. Regular Inspections

    • Inspect your welder regularly for signs of wear and tear, damage, or contamination. Check cables, connectors, and electrode holders for any issues and replace them as needed.
  2. Cleanliness

    • Keep your welder clean from dust, dirt, and spatter. Use appropriate cleaning tools and solvents to remove build-up and ensure proper function.
  3. Proper Storage

    • Store your welder in a clean, dry place to prevent contamination and damage. Use protective covers or cases to keep it organized and easily accessible.
  4. Follow Manufacturer’s Recommendations

    • Adhere to the manufacturer’s guidelines for installation, maintenance, and replacement of parts. This ensures that you get the best performance and longevity from your welder.
